Charles Duhigg is a Pulitzer Prize-winning journalist and bestselling author. He chats with Dr. Anthony Gustin about the science of “Supercommunicators.”
According to Charles, Supercommunicators have unlocked the secret language of connection. This one trait makes them more successful in all areas of their life.
Best part? Anyone can become a Supercommunicator!
If you’re familiar with Charles’ books The Power of Habit and Smarter Faster Better, you know he takes a science-driven approach to understanding human nature and its potential for transformation.
His new book, Supercommunicators, is no different. It’s full of science-backed tips and tricks for more effective, connection-boosting conversations.
So in this episode, Charles and Dr. Gustin explore:
The science of communication, conversation, and connection
Why communication is a human superpower
The benefits of being a better communicator
The three types of conversations
How the “Matching Principle” explains miscommunication
The difference between inviting vs. mandating conversations
What makes Supercommunicators so effective
How to ask deep questions to better connect with others (+ the best one to ask!)
What “looping for understanding” means, and how it’s helpful during conflict or arguments
